A 5.6-inch inch height of the ice cream cone has a radius of 1.6 inches. A spherical scoop of ice cream also has a radius equal to 1.6 inches. What is the difference between the volume of the ice cream cone and the volume of the ice cream? Round your answer to nearest tenth.
